The following year Empire Rose won the Mackinnon Stakes on Saturday 29 October, then made her third attempt at the “Race that stops two nations” in the 1988 Melbourne Cup on the following Tuesday, November the 1st.
Young rider Tony Allan had the mare handily placed all the way and she led the big field around the home turn.
Despite a flashing finish from Natski, Empire Rose refused to give in, winning by a short head on the line.
Later that year as a seven-year-old, Empire Rose finished 3rd in the Cox Plate behind Almaarad and Stylish Century followed by a 5th in the Mackinnon Stakes behind Horlicks.
On 12 March 2002 Empire Rose was euthanized at her birthplace and home, Whakanui Stud, in Hamilton, New Zealand, due to deteriorating health and an incurable foot problem.
